Are you sure the debt bomb is a bomb? Private debt can be a major concern, but government debt may not work the way you think it does. In fact, the great depression was preceded (and possibly in some ways triggered) by a significant paying down of public debt, counterbalanced by an increase in private debt that kept the money supply growing through the roaring 20s.


I understand the Keynesian dynamics of maintaining money velocity through government spending, but it's a balancing act, and I'm pretty sure we're way off balance now.
